Description

This is a magnificent katana by the Mukansa swordsmith Yakuwa Yasutake, made in Showa 42 (1967) at the age of 58. It is a grand work exceeding three shaku in length, crafted with a wide and thick body, high koshi-zori, and a deeply carved bo-hi. The jitetsu shows an old-fashioned hada with a mix of itame and komokume, covered in thick ko-nie, while the hamon is a gunome-choji midare with varied patterns and bright nie-deki.

NTHK Appraisal
Kanteishō鑑定書
NTHK Appraisal Certificate
›

The NTHK’s principal certificate, issued for a blade of considerable quality. It confirms a genuine signature, or, for an unsigned (mumei) work, records the judges’ attribution to a smith or school. The paper carries a detailed worksheet with a numerical point score.

About the NTHK›

The NTHK (Nihon Tōken Hozon Kai, the Society for the Preservation of the Japanese Sword) is the oldest of Japan’s sword-appraisal bodies, founded in 1910, decades before the NBTHK. After the death of its long-serving head it divided into two successor societies, the NTHK and the NTHK-NPO, both of which continue to hold shinsa. NTHK certificates are known for a detailed worksheet that records a numerical point score alongside the judges’ written opinion, and the society is especially respected for its attribution of unsigned (mumei) work.
